Kyler Murray trains with Jordan Addison before Vikings camp
Kyler Murray, the newly acquired quarterback of the Minnesota Vikings, has spent two months training with wide receiver Jordan Addison in Dallas, according to NFL insider reports. Both players traveled to Minnesota in early May 2026 to join the team’s offseason program ahead of training camp.
The private sessions are intended to build chemistry and may give Murray an edge in the ongoing competition with fellow quarterback J.J. McCarthy for the starting role, though they cannot replace full-team practices or defensive pressure.
